Walk 1165 - The Quirang, Isle of Skye
| County/Area | Highland | | Author | Lou Johnson | | Length | 3.5 miles / 5.7 km | | Ascent | 430 feet / 130 metres | | Grade | easy |

The Quirang on the eastern side of the Isle of Skye is the objective of this short walk. The highlight is the interesting rock architecture and the views, which on a good day are exceptional.
